      Hello, I’m using PinUpDisplay.exe 1.4.4 and having trouble setting the back glass to display#2. I can drag it to display#2 and set it to full screen correctly, but every time i save the back glass moves back to display #1.

      I  in version 1.3.0 I am able to reference display#2 correctly. DirectB2S is working correctly also.

      Anyone have any ideas on what to check to get PinUpDisplay.exe 1.4.4 to set my second display correctly ?

        You most likely don’t have your monitors in Windows setup correctly. 1.44 does a check for this and won’t position the pup display in a negative position.

        Your Backglass monitor is probably positioned in a negative position (above the x position of the playfield or to the left of the playfield). Even if it’s only by a few pixels that’s enough.

          TerryRed, Thank you, that’s exactly what the problem was. Moving the back glass and topper screens below the playfield instead of above solved the problem.

            To be more accurate, they should be “beside” the playfield and lined up perfectly. Great you got it working!
